A tantrum isn’t “naughty.”
Backchat isn’t “disrespect.”
Shutting down isn’t “rude.”
Crying over small things isn’t “overreacting.”
They’re all messages:
📌 “I’m overwhelmed.”
📌 “I don’t feel heard.”
📌 “I’m scared of getting it wrong.”
📌 “I don’t know how to cope with this feeling.”
Children show us their feelings through behaviour long before they can tell us with words.
So your superpower isn’t being the “perfect parent.”
It’s being the safe place.
🧠 Pause before reacting
💛 Get curious instead of furious
🗣️ “What’s really happening for my child right now?”
Connection first → behaviour follows.
You’re not raising a perfectly behaved child.
You’re raising a human who knows they’re loved when they’re at their worst.
And that changes everything. 🤍
